Output df5869728aa3889300af06e57b8fc2ffb87fdeda2d12bcfbb482389cdfe08134:66

value
72727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3443f652fbb46720723cb9851678ba59b1e7ee OP_EQUAL
address
34SiomUnbBDSVSvLjKA4dyfpXMBHWi6fPn
transaction
df5869728aa3889300af06e57b8fc2ffb87fdeda2d12bcfbb482389cdfe08134
confirmations
249939
spent
true